Lsass.exe audit mode

Verified with Microsoft Security Baseline (MSS / SecGuide) 25H2 — updated on July 10, 2026

Supported on: At least Windows Server 2012 R2, Windows 8.1 or Windows RT 8.1

Path in the GPO console

Computer Configuration\Administrative Templates\MS Security Guide

Description

Enable auditing of Lsass.exe to evaluate feasibility of enabling LSA protection. For more information, see http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/dn408187.aspx

Registry

HKLM S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\LSASS.exe

Value name: AuditLevel

Enabled: AuditLevel = 8

Disabled: AuditLevel = 0
